The Training Coordinator is responsible for successfully preparing, coordinating, and directing all projects within the assigned area. As a Training Coordinator, you must demonstrate the ability to facilitate, monitor, evaluate and document training activities within the company, and that the staff completes each phase of the project safely within the scheduled timeline.
Responsibilities
- Assess training needs for new and existing employees
- Identify internal and external training programs to address competency gaps
- Develop training aids such as manuals and handbooks
- Organize, develop or source training programs to meet specific training needs
- Map out training plans for individual employees
- Present training programs using recognized training techniques and tools
- Facilitate learning through a variety of delivery methods including classroom instruction, virtual training, on-the job coaching
- Design and apply assessment tools to measure training effectiveness
- Track and report on training outcomes
- Provide feedback to program participants and management
- Establish and maintain relationships with external training suppliers
- Manage and maintain in-house training facilities and equipment
- Keep current on training design and methodology
